  23. using System;
  24. using System.Reflection;
  25. using System.Reflection.Emit;
  26. namespace Mono.CodeGeneration
  27. {
  28. public class CodeEquals: CodeConditionExpression
  29. {
  30. CodeExpression exp1;
  31. CodeExpression exp2;
  32. Type t1;
  33. Type t2;
  34. public CodeEquals (CodeExpression exp1, CodeExpression exp2)
  35. {
  36. this.exp1 = exp1;
  37. this.exp2 = exp2;
  38. t1 = exp1.GetResultType ();
  39. t2 = exp2.GetResultType ();
  40. if (t1.IsValueType && t2.IsValueType) {
  41. if (t1 != t2)
  42. throw new InvalidOperationException ("Can't compare values of different primitive types");
  43. }
  44. }
  45. public override void Generate (ILGenerator gen)
  46. {
  47. if (t1.IsPrimitive)
  48. {
  49. exp1.Generate (gen);
  50. exp2.Generate (gen);
  51. gen.Emit (OpCodes.Ceq);
  52. }
  53. else
  54. {
  55. exp1.Generate (gen);
  56. exp2.Generate (gen);
  57. // gen.Emit (OpCodes.Ceq);
  58. gen.EmitCall (OpCodes.Callvirt, t1.GetMethod ("Equals", new Type[] {t2}), null);
  59. }
  60. }
  61. public override void GenerateForBranch (ILGenerator gen, Label label, bool branchCase)
  62. {
  63. if (t1.IsPrimitive)
  64. {
  65. exp1.Generate (gen);
  66. exp2.Generate (gen);
  67. if (branchCase)
  68. gen.Emit (OpCodes.Beq, label);
  69. else
  70. gen.Emit (OpCodes.Bne_Un, label);
  71. }
  72. else {
  73. Generate (gen);
  74. if (branchCase)
  75. gen.Emit (OpCodes.Brtrue, label);
  76. else
  77. gen.Emit (OpCodes.Brfalse, label);
  78. }
  79. }
  80. public override void PrintCode (CodeWriter cp)
  81. {
  82. exp1.PrintCode (cp);
  83. cp.Write (" == ");
  84. exp2.PrintCode (cp);
  85. }
  86. public override Type GetResultType ()
  87. {
  88. return typeof (bool);
  89. }
  90. }
  91. }
